History

The Town Council of Georgetown created the Planning and Zoning Department in July of 2001. The Department moved out of the Town Hall and is located in the south side of the Police Department on North Race Street. The Department was made up of two Code Enforcement Officers and one Director to oversee the daily operations.

The Department has seen an increased volume in issues involving permitting, site plans, subdivision and annexation reviews since established in 2001. Based on the increase development demand as of January 2007, the Department is staffed with a Secretary, an Administrative Assistant, a Code Enforcement Officer and a Director who hold the following responsibilities:

Positions and Responsibilities

  • Jamie Craddock, Secretary
    Jamie is tasked with the Department's purchasing, building permit and business license applications, Board / Commission support (agenda's and packets), posting agendas and Public Notices in the newspaper, notifying Post Office of address changes, daily cash receipt reconciliation, plan review applications, as well assisting the general public.
  • Dominic Santangelo, Code Enforcement
    Dominic is tasked with the Town's housing issues (overcrowding, condemnation, maintenance), code complaints (detrimental objects, animals, grass / vegetation height, trash dumpsters), and enforcement of business licensing and building permits.
  • Tom Klein, Director
    Tom is tasked with overseeing the operation of the Department, providing direction and clarification to the staff, attending the Board / Commission / Outside Agency Meetings, as well as providing updated development and growth information to the public / Town Officials. He also reviews plan applications (Category II site plans, variances / exceptions, zoning amendment, Historic sign reviews) and building permits.

Comprehensive Plan

The Town's Comprehensive Plan was adopted in October of 2001. The intent of the comprehensive plan is to guide the officials of Georgetown in making decisions concerning the present and future of the Town. Code of the Town of Georgetown

The Code of the Town of Georgetown provides all the rules and regulations set forth by the Mayor and Council. The Code is divided into two major divisions.
